What is RFID engineering?

RFID engineering is the field focused on the design, development, implementation, and maintenance of Radio Frequency Identification (RFID) systems. RFID engineers work with technologies that use radio waves to identify and track objects, people, or animals automatically. Their responsibilities may include hardware design, software development, system integration, troubleshooting, and ensuring data security. RFID engineers are employed across industries such as logistics, retail, healthcare, and manufacturing to improve inventory management and operational efficiency.

What are some common challenges faced by RFID engineers when integrating RFID systems into existing workflows?

RFID engineers often encounter challenges such as ensuring compatibility between new RFID hardware and legacy IT systems, managing interference from environmental factors like metal surfaces or electronic noise, and maintaining data accuracy during high-volume scanning. Collaboration with IT, operations, and supply chain teams is critical to address these issues and tailor solutions to specific business needs. Proactively testing and troubleshooting in real-world environments helps ensure a smooth deployment and long-term reliability of the RFID system.

What are the key skills and qualifications needed to thrive as an RFID engineer, and why are they important?

To thrive as an RFID Engineer, you need a solid background in electrical engineering, wireless communication, and embedded systems, often supported by a relevant engineering degree. Familiarity with RFID hardware, antenna design, RFID reader/writer configuration, and programming languages like C/C++ or Python is typically required, along with certifications such as CompTIA RFID+ being advantageous. Strong problem-solving skills, attention to detail, and effective communication are essential soft skills in this role. These abilities are crucial for designing, implementing, and troubleshooting RFID solutions that meet organizational needs and comply with industry standards.

Is RFID engineering in demand?

RFID engineering is in demand as companies increasingly adopt RFID technology for inventory management, supply chain tracking, and asset identification. Professionals with skills in RFID system design, integration, and related tools like antennas and readers are sought after in various industries, including retail, logistics, and manufacturing.

The Role
Mach Industries builds autonomous defense platforms, and the precision components inside them start with great tooling. As our Senior CNC Tooling Engineer, you'll own the entire tooling ecosystem behind our CNC operations - from tool selection and standardization to data management and continuous improvement across every production cell.
This is a high-ownership, shop-floor role. You'll be the bridge between Manufacturing Engineering, CNC Programming, Machinists, Supply Chain, and Production leadership, building a digital-first tooling program that drives faster setups, longer tool life, and lower cost-per-part. If you love creating order from complexity and want your expertise to directly strengthen U.S. national security, this is your seat.
Key Responsibilities
  • Own our CNC tool database - tool records, assemblies, holders, offsets, cutting data, and standard libraries.
  • Standardize tooling across machines, CAM platforms, and cells to cut variation and boost repeatability.
  • Build tool assemblies and define standards for holders, shrink-fit systems, gauge length, runout, balance, stick-out, and coolant delivery.
  • Optimize tool selection to balance tool life, cycle time, surface finish, cost, and reliability.
  • Connect tooling data across CAM, presetters, machine controls, smart cabinets, and production docs.
  • Manage inventory through vending/smart cabinet systems - min/max levels, reorder points, consumption tracking.
  • Analyze wear, failure modes, and usage to extend tool life and drive down cost per part.
  • Lead root-cause analysis on chatter, poor finish, premature wear, breakage, and dimensional drift.
  • Drive RFID/barcode tool-ID systems and create the work instructions and training that keep practices consistent across shifts.
Required Qualifications
  • 5+ years hands-on experience in CNC machining, tooling selection, manufacturing engineering, or tool crib management.
  • Deep knowledge of cutting tools, toolholding, inserts, coatings, geometries, feeds/speeds, and material-specific strategies.
  • Experience standardizing tooling for milling, turning, drilling, boring, threading, and finishing.
  • Working knowledge of CAM systems, tool libraries, and CNC production workflows.
  • A data-driven mindset and strong documentation discipline - you build standards people actually follow.
  • High ownership and urgency in a fast-paced manufacturing environment.
